Fear in Non-Horror Games by Dry_Historian_6547 in casualnintendo

[–]Flyron 1 point2 points  (0 children)

No, the solar system is quite small actually. You get from one end to the other in a few minutes. But flying through space is exhilarating because you actually have to think in terms of space travel to not crash into the sun or one of the planets. The game is designed in a way that failing does not set you back more than a few minutes. You will crash, burn, suffocate, etc. but it‘s all part of the learning experience.

All those planets are also quite small but they‘re intricately designed to present unique settings and mechanics, each you have to learn to work with to progress towards the end of the game.

It is a game you only get to experience yourself once, but it will haunt you for a long time.

Does Java need deconstructible classes? by danielaveryj in java

[–]Flyron 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Did you measure that yourself? In my own tests streams need a little warmup, but through repeated construction and execution they become just as fast as the usual for-each (<10% margin). So it depends if you're programming short-lived apps or long-running apps, but in general there is no effective performance gap.

New-ish to Minecraft and ATM10 by Aggravating-Sock-857 in allthemods

[–]Flyron 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Nah. I got through ATM10 with Refined Storage just fine. When you have spent some time interfacing your automation setups (based on modular routers, xnet, sfm, or whatever) with crafters and exporters/importers, there is nothing you can't do with RS. And to me it's much easier to achieve (no meteor hunting) and more convenient to use (no artificial channel limits).
